Today is my due date. I would not have imagined that instead of nursing my son, my husband and I would be spreading his ashes in the Pacific.  It has been three of the hardest months of my life. I thought I was getting better but this morning, my reality hit me like a ton of bricks.  I cried so hard that my eyes were swollen shut. Grief sucks. It has taken over my life. My life currently is still in such a stand still that I don’t have any distractions from my pain. How do you handle your due date?
